Associate Data Analyst_

Madison

**Overview**

Public Consulting Group LLC (PCG) is a leading public sector solutions implementation and operations improvement firm that partners with health, education, and human services agencies to improve lives. Founded in 1986, PCG employs approximately 2,000 professionals throughout the U.S.—all committed to delivering solutions that change lives for the better. The firm is a member of a family of companies with experience in all 50 states, and clients in six Canadian provinces and Europe. PCG offers clients a multidisciplinary approach to meet challenges, pursue opportunities, and serve constituents across the public sector. To learn more, visit www.publicconsultinggroup.com .

**Responsibilities**

**Duties & Responsibilities:**

• Responsible for the management of data dictionaries, data flow diagrams, etc. for all products and related services.

• Gather data from primary and secondary sources, ensuring the upkeep of databases and data systems.

• Detect, examine, and decode trends or patterns within intricate datasets.

• Cleanse data and scrutinize computer-generated reports and outputs to identify and rectify coding errors.

• Coordinate with management to align business and informational priorities.

• Identify opportunities for process enhancements.

• Employ statistical techniques to scrutinize data and produce actionable business insights.

• Collaborate with the management team to determine and rank the needs of different business units.

• Develop data dashboards, charts, and visual aids to support decision-making across product lines.

• Convey insights through both reports and visual presentations.

• Engage with managers from various departments to specify data requirements for analysis projects tailored to their unique business processes.

• Ad hoc data processing ETL and review as needed.
